HELP! 97 E320 W210 Aux Fan Not Working

I replaced a leaky a/c hose in a friend's 97 E320 - it was a massive leak. The system calls for 33.5 oz of R134a. After vacuuming for 2 hours I only have 2 cans in there now (24 oz.) and the high pressure is already over 400psi. I found the problem: the aux fan is not kicking in at all. Ever. I watched the gauge start climbing towards 425 and no fan, so I shut it off.

I'm guessing the old hose sprung a leak due to excessive pressures when idling.

I did a search, and there is plenty on the W124, but I can't find much of anything on the W210 aux fan. Where do I start?
